Abstract

The invention discloses an environmentally-friendly building biological material. The environmentally-friendly building biological material comprises, by weight, 50-80 parts of cement, 20-30 parts of gypsum powder, 10-12 parts of a thickening agent, 3-9 parts of Meretrix meretrix Linnaeus shell powder, 2-6 parts of oyster shell powder, 7-12 parts of neptune shell powder, 1-8 parts of hydroxyethyl cellulose, 3-6 parts of wood chips of Chinese pine, 9-14 parts of wood chips of Korean pine, 2-6 parts of wood chips of black walnut, 9-12 parts of wood chips of lemon, 5-8 parts of stearic acid, 3-8 parts of potassium dihydrogen phosphate, 2-5 parts of sodium borate and 4-9 parts of a cosolvent. The environmentally-friendly building biological material does not produce pollution and irritation, has good permeability, a small heat conduction coefficient, a large coefficient of heat insulation, high bonding strength, good environmental friendliness, good safety and good applicability, saves energy and has good heat preservation, thermal insulation and flame retardance effects, a high compression resistance coefficient, good cracking resistance, a low price, a wide application range and a low production cost.
